Staff in these areas are doing the best they can with what they have, learning from who remains. The difference between experience and expertise lies in their nature and development. Experience refers to the practical knowledge and skills gained through direct involvement and exposure to a particular activity or field. It is acquired through hands-on practice, observation, and learning from real-life situations.On the other hand, expertise refers to a high level of proficiency and mastery in a specific area or subject. It is often the result of extensive experience combined with continuous learning, studying, and refining one's skills and knowledge. Expertise goes beyond mere familiarity with a task or field and involves a deep understanding and ability to perform at an advanced level.While experience is essential for building expertise, it is possible to have experience without necessarily becoming an expert. Experience provides the foundation for expertise, but it is the deliberate effort to learn, improve, and specialize that transforms experience into expertise.In summary, experience is the accumulation of practical knowledge gained through direct involvement, while expertise is the advanced level of skill and understanding achieved through continuous learning and development.
